Windows.UI.Input.Inking.Core 命名空间
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
替代默认 InkPresenter 运行时行为,为Windows Ink应用提供高级输入、处理和管理支持。
Windows.UI.Input.Inking.Core API 使你能够:
- 在呈现墨迹笔划后发生的标准 InkPresenter 事件之前处理墨迹笔划事件和指针事件。
- 截获原始指针数据,并在笔划的任意点取消或取消墨迹呈现。 在保护现有墨迹笔划或提供自定义手势支持(如长按)而不创建墨迹项目时,这非常有用。
- 控制墨迹笔划的呈现路径。 这对于自动更正用户的笔划或绘图图面的遮罩区域非常有用。
- 使用单个 InkPoint 对象以增量方式绘制 墨迹 笔划。
重要
Windows.UI.Input.Inking.Core 处理发生在墨迹后台线程上。 因此,请确保墨迹输入的任何自定义处理都尽可能轻,以避免性能下降,并使应用尽可能响应。
类
CoreIncrementalInkStroke |
表示可以使用单个 InkPoint 对象以增量方式呈现的 单个墨迹 笔划。 |
CoreInkIndependentInputSource |
提供属性、方法和事件,用于在 由 InkPresenter 对象处理之前处理指针输入。 重要 这些事件发生在墨迹后台线程上。 因此,请确保墨迹输入的任何自定义处理都尽可能轻,以避免性能下降,并使应用尽可能响应。 |
CoreInkPresenterHost |
表示一个对象,该对象托管 InkPresenter 而无需 InkCanvas 控件。 |
CoreWetStrokeUpdateEventArgs |
包含 InkPresenter 对象的墨迹 笔划事件数据。 |
CoreWetStrokeUpdateSource |
表示管理墨迹笔划数据的输入、处理和呈现的 InkPresenter 。 |
枚举
CoreWetStrokeDisposition |
定义指定预呈现状态 (处置) “湿”墨迹笔划的常量。 |